What Is a Conventional Oil Change?
A conventional oil change involves replacing your engine’s existing oil with traditional petroleum-based motor oil refined directly from crude oil. This process has been the standard for engine maintenance since the early days of automotive history. During a conventional oil change, the old oil is drained from the engine, the oil filter is replaced, and fresh conventional oil is added according to your vehicle’s specifications. Conventional motor oil provides essential lubrication to engine components, reducing friction and heat while preventing wear and tear. Despite the increasing availability of synthetic alternatives, conventional oil continues to serve as a reliable option for many vehicles, particularly older models and those with simpler engine designs.
Conventional Oil Vs Synthetic Oil: Understanding the Key Differences
Composition and Refinement
The primary distinction between conventional and synthetic oils lies in their molecular structure and manufacturing process. Conventional oil undergoes basic refinement from crude oil, maintaining a more varied molecular structure. In contrast, synthetic oil is engineered through advanced chemical processes to create uniform molecules with enhanced performance characteristics. Synthetic blend oil represents a middle ground, combining conventional oil with synthetic components to offer improved performance at a moderate price point compared to full synthetic oil.
Performance Comparison Table
| Feature | Conventional Oil | Synthetic Blend Oil | Full Synthetic Oil |
| Price Point | Most economical | Moderate | Premium pricing |
| Change Interval | 3,000-5,000 miles | 5,000-7,500 miles | 7,500-15,000 miles |
| Temperature Performance | Standard | Enhanced | Superior |
| Engine Protection | Adequate | Good | Excellent |
| Oxidation Resistance | Basic | Improved | Maximum |
| Best For | Older vehicles, simple engines | Mixed driving conditions | High-performance, modern engines |

Regular Oil Vs Synthetic: Which Should You Choose?
Choosing conventional oil makes sense in several scenarios:
● Older vehicles: Cars manufactured before 1990 often perform perfectly well with conventional oil, as their engines were designed with this lubricant in mind
● Simple engine designs: Vehicles with straightforward, non-turbocharged engines typically don’t require the advanced protection of synthetic oils
● Low-mileage driving: If you drive primarily in moderate conditions with regular short trips, conventional oil provides sufficient protection
● Budget considerations: When cost is a primary concern and your vehicle doesn’t specifically require synthetic oil, conventional options offer excellent value
● Frequent oil changes: Drivers who prefer changing oil every 3,000 miles may find conventional oil more economical
Thinking when to Consider Synthetic Options?
Synthetic oil vs regular oil becomes a crucial decision for certain vehicles and driving conditions:
● Modern engines with turbochargers or superchargers
● Extreme temperature environments (very hot or very cold climates)
● High-performance vehicles requiring 5w30 full synthetic oil or similar specifications
● Vehicles used for towing or heavy hauling
● Extended drain intervals recommended by manufacturers.
Blended Synthetic Vs Fully Synthetic: Breaking Down the Middle Ground
The debate between blended synthetic vs fully synthetic often confuses car owners. Synthetic blend oil contains approximately 70% conventional oil mixed with 30% synthetic base stock, offering enhanced protection over conventional oil without the premium price tag of fully synthetic oil.
Benefits of Synthetic Blend Oil
● Improved cold-weather starting compared to conventional oil
● Better high-temperature stability than normal oil
● Extended change intervals versus conventional oil
● Cost-effective upgrade for moderate-performance vehicles
● Ideal for trucks, SUVs, and vehicles carrying heavier loads
Cost Analysis: Conventional Oil Change Economics
A typical conventional oil change costs between $30-$60 at most service centers, significantly less than the $70-$125 range for full synthetic services. Over a year, with conventional oil requiring changes every 3,000-5,000 miles, the annual maintenance cost remains predictable and manageable for budget-conscious drivers. However, when comparing long-term expenses, synthetic and fully synthetic oil options may offer better value despite higher upfront costs due to extended change intervals and superior engine protection that can reduce wear-related repairs.

Best Practices for Conventional Oil Changes
Recommended Change Intervals
| Driving Condition | Mileage Interval | Time Interval |
| Severe driving conditions | Every 3,000 miles | Every 3 months |
| Normal driving patterns | Every 5,000 miles | Every 6 months |
| General rule | Follow manufacturer guidelines | Whichever comes first |
Signs You Need an Oil Change
| Indicator | What to Look For |
| Oil appearance | Dark, dirty appearance when checking the dipstick |
| Engine sounds | Unusual engine noises or knocking |
| Dashboard warning | Oil change indicator light illuminated |
| Performance | Decreased fuel efficiency |
| Emissions | Exhaust smoke or burning oil smell |

Frequently Asked Question
How often should I get a conventional oil change?
Most experts recommend changing conventional oil every 3,000 to 5,000 miles, depending on driving conditions and manufacturer specifications. Severe conditions like frequent short trips, extreme temperatures, or stop-and-go traffic may require more frequent changes.
Can I switch from synthetic oil back to conventional oil?
Yes, you can safely switch from synthetic to conventional oil without harming your engine. However, consider why you were using synthetic oil initially if your vehicle requires it for performance or warranty reasons, reverting to conventional oil may not be advisable.
Is conventional oil bad for newer cars?
Not necessarily. While many modern vehicles are designed to maximize the benefits of synthetic oil, some newer cars still perform excellently with conventional oil. Always check your owner’s manual for manufacturer recommendations.
What happens if I wait too long between conventional oil changes?
Delaying oil changes causes oil to break down, losing its lubricating properties. This can lead to increased engine wear, sludge buildup, reduced fuel efficiency, and potentially catastrophic engine damage requiring costly repairs.
Does conventional oil work in extreme temperatures?
Conventional oil functions adequately in moderate climates but may struggle in extreme heat or cold. If you regularly experience temperatures below 0°F or above 100°F, synthetic or synthetic blend oil offers better protection.
